About 19 Fenton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

19 Fenton Road is a two-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Birmingham (B27 6HY). It has a recorded floor area of 54 m² (around 581 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(February 2019) shows a D (score 62),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 89),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ity.

Across 2006–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.9%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£211,000 is 27.9%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£284/sq ft) was about 141.8%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: January 2021 at £165,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
